Whiplash and going to court for pain and suffering...?? |
This is the problem. I had a car accident last February and hurt the left side of my neck. I did physio for about 6 months which didn't help at all. Now, for the last month or so, my left hand and arm becomes numb. My doctor says it's related to my neck but it would be hard to prove it's because of the accident because I already had arthritis in my neck. I'm waiting for a cat scan which could take up to 6 months to get. My lawyer isn't really impressed with my doctor. He says she doesn't do much to help me. He called me yesterday and told me to go see her again because he needs more details. Just whiplash isn't enough. Plus, I am really scared in a car now and I don't go on highways at all. This is really stressing me out. My doctor isn't helping much and my lawyer is after me. What should I do, sometimes, I just feel like dropping everything! Any suggestions would be greatly appreciated? I have tried changing family doctors and none accept new patients so I have no choice but to keep her. If you have been treating with this doctor its hard to try to switch now. Your doctor needs to state in her narrative that you sustained permanent injuries that are CASUALLY connected to the accident. If her narrative is unclear, states degeneration or doesn't really specify permanency you are going to have an issue which is why your attorney is bugging you. If you can't get your doctor to do it, speak to your attorney...I'm sure he has doctors that he works with that would be able to write a favorable report. Good luck!
